On Thu, 5 Dec 1996, Ken Ingram wrote:
> What's the 'compat 20 stuff' and where is it?

Sorry, i mean the FreeBSD 2.0 compatibility package, that you can find
on the CDROM in the /dists/compat20 directory (filename: compat20.tgz)
or on ftp.freebsd.org/pub/FreeBSD/x.y.z-RELEASE/compat20
You can install it by executing the install.sh script (which is in the
same directory) or using tar (or maybe using /stand/sysinstall, but i'm
not sure).
